本文目录导读:
随着互联网技术的飞速发展,越来越多的企业和个人开始关注服务器的性能和稳定性,为了满足不断增长的业务需求,提高服务器的运行效率,降低运营成本,服务器可负载化技术应运而生,本文将深入剖析服务器可负载化的原理、技术特点、应用场景以及实践方法,帮助大家更好地理解和应用这一技术。
服务器可负载化原理
服务器可负载化技术,又称为服务器负载均衡技术,是一种通过将多台服务器组成一个集群,实现对业务请求的动态分配和调度,以提高服务器资源利用率、降低单台服务器压力、提升系统整体性能的技术,就是将用户请求分发到多台服务器上,让每台服务器都参与到处理请求的过程中,从而实现负载均衡。
服务器可负载化技术特点
1、高可用性:通过将多台服务器组成集群,当某台服务器出现故障时,其他服务器可以接管其工作,保证业务的正常运行。
2、扩展性强:可以根据业务需求,随时增加或减少服务器数量,实现弹性伸缩。
3、负载均衡:根据服务器的负载情况,动态调整请求的分配策略,确保每台服务器都能得到充分利用。
4、数据一致性:在多台服务器之间实现数据的同步和一致性,避免数据丢失和不一致的问题。
5、安全性:通过负载均衡器对请求进行安全检查,防止恶意攻击和非法访问。
服务器可负载化应用场景
1、网站应用:通过负载均衡技术,将用户请求分发到多台服务器上,提高网站的响应速度和并发处理能力。
2、数据库应用:通过主从复制和读写分离技术,实现数据库的负载均衡和高可用性。
3、云计算:在云计算环境中,通过负载均衡技术,实现虚拟机之间的资源调度和负载均衡。
4、大数据分析:通过分布式计算框架,将大数据任务分发到多台服务器上,实现负载均衡和并行处理。
服务器可负载化实践方法
1、硬件负载均衡:通过专门的负载均衡设备,实现对服务器的负载均衡,硬件负载均衡具有较高的性能和稳定性,但成本较高。
2、软件负载均衡:通过安装在服务器上的负载均衡软件,实现对服务器的负载均衡,软件负载均衡具有成本低、部署灵活的优点,但性能和稳定性相对较低。
3、DNS负载均衡:通过修改DNS解析记录,实现对不同服务器的负载均衡,DNS负载均衡简单易用,但性能较低,适用于对性能要求不高的场景。
4、基于操作系统的负载均衡:通过操作系统提供的负载均衡功能,实现对服务器的负载均衡,这种方法具有较高的性能和稳定性,但需要对操作系统进行配置和管理。
服务器可负载化技术是提高服务器性能、降低运营成本的重要手段,通过深入了解和应用负载均衡技术,我们可以为企业和个人带来更高的业务价值。